Transaction 72a91d16739e224c76d2eb59c90532e9cc46637eca98209c8fe73678a00945d1
2 Input
2 Outputs
- 72a91d16739e224c76d2eb59c90532e9cc46637eca98209c8fe73678a00945d1:0
- 72a91d16739e224c76d2eb59c90532e9cc46637eca98209c8fe73678a00945d1:1
value 101098901
address 1P57PSVPSHRr3D6NS3mZE2ncFC8Tmn3rph
value 357061
address 16EgocF3WPsmb7dWrDBLLvGBNgpo7wNvrQ